A note on the Hurwitz action on reflection factorizations of Coxeter elements in complex reflection groups
From MaRDI portal
Publication:6333336
DOI10.37236/9351arXiv2001.08238WikidataQ114023829 ScholiaQ114023829MaRDI QIDQ6333336FDOQ6333336
Authors: Joel Brewster Lewis
Publication date: 22 January 2020
Abstract: We show that the Hurwitz action is "as transitive as possible" on reflection factorizations of Coxeter elements in the well-generated complex reflection groups (the group of -colored permutations) and .
